Sant'Agostino: A Church of Historical Depth

Sant'Agostino stands as a testament to Modena's rich religious heritage. Founded in the 12th century, this church represents an important chapter in the city's ecclesiastical history.

The structure exhibits beautiful Romanesque architecture, characterized by its sturdy stonework and intricate detailing. Key features include a striking façade and a serene interior that houses significant artworks and relics of cultural value.

Must-See Wonders

⛪ Architectural Features: The church displays refined Romanesque styles, showcasing architectural craftsmanship.

🎨 Art Collection: Inside, you'll find remarkable frescoes and statues that reflect the artistic tradition of the region.

📜 Historical Significance: Known as a center for theological study, it continues to be an inspirational site for historians and worshippers alike.

Sant'Agostino is accessible to all, with free entry, making it an inviting destination for tourists, families, and history enthusiasts interested in Italy's religious artistry.
